About this map

Hermiston serves as a major agricultural and transportation hub in Umatilla County, where the Umatilla River meanders past the prominent Hermiston Butte. The landscape is a complex network of irrigation, featuring the Aqueduct, various canals like the Z Canal, and numerous ditches that support the region's farms and the Hermiston Agricultural Research Center. The southern portion of the map is dominated by the massive Hinkle Yards rail facility, a vital node for the Union Pacific railroad, illustrating the area's importance in regional logistics.
